Step 1: Understanding Castigliano’s second theorem. Castigliano’s second theorem is used to determine the displacements in statically indeterminate structures. It states that the displacement of a point in a structure is equal to the partial derivative of the total strain energy with respect to the force applied at that point. Step 2: Principle employed. The principle of least work is applied in conjunction with Castigliano’s second theorem to solve for the unknown forces in statically indeterminate structures. The principle states that the strain energy in the structure is minimized when the equilibrium conditions are satisfied. Conclusion: Castigliano’s second theorem employs the principle of least work, which matches option \( \mathbf{(D)} \).
